| ## JLLWrappers musl SONAME workaround | ||
| # | ||
| # The problem is detailed in this thread [0], but in short: | ||
| # | ||
| # JLLs rely on a specific behavior of most `dlopen()` implementations; that if | ||
| # a library with the same SONAME will not be loaded twice; e.g. if you first | ||
| # load `/a/libfoo.so`, loading `/b/libbar.so` which declares a dependency on | ||
| # `libfoo.so` will find the previously-loaded `libfoo.so` without needing to | ||
| # search because the SONAME `libbar.so` looks for matches the SONAME of the | ||
| # previously-loaded `libfoo.so`. This allows JLLs to store libraries all over | ||
| # the place, and directly `dlopen()` all dependencies before any dependents | ||
| # would trigger a system-wide search. | ||
| # | ||
| # Musl does not do this. They do have a mechanism for skipping the directory | ||
| # search, but it is only invoked when loading a library without specifying | ||
| # the full path [1]. This means that when checking for dependencies, musl | ||
| # skips all libraries that were loaded by full path [2]. All that needs to | ||
| # happen is that musl needs to record the `shortname` (e.g. SONAME) of all | ||
| # libraries, but sadly there's no way to do that if we also want to specify | ||
| # the library unambiguously [3,2]. Manipulating the environment to allow for | ||
| # non-fully-specified searches to work (e.g. changing `LD_LIBRARY_PATH` then | ||
| # invoking `dlopen("libfoo.so")`) won't work, as the environment is only read | ||
| # at process initialization. We are therefore backed into a corner and must | ||
| # resort to heroic measures: manually inserting an appropriate `shortname`. | ||
| # | ||
| # [0] https://github.com/JuliaLang/julia/issues/40556 | ||
| # [1] https://github.com/ifduyue/musl/blob/aad50fcd791e009961621ddfbe3d4c245fd689a3/ldso/dynlink.c#L1163-L1164 | ||
| # [2] https://github.com/ifduyue/musl/blob/aad50fcd791e009961621ddfbe3d4c245fd689a3/ldso/dynlink.c#L1047-L1052 | ||
| # [3] https://github.com/ifduyue/musl/blob/aad50fcd791e009961621ddfbe3d4c245fd689a3/ldso/dynlink.c#L1043-L1044 | ||

| using Libdl | ||
|
|
||
| # Use this to ensure the GC doesn't clean up values we insert into musl. | ||
| manual_gc_roots = String[] | ||
|
|
||
| ## We define these structures so that Julia's internal struct padding logic | ||
| ## can do some arithmetic for us, instead of us needing to do manual offset | ||
| ## calculation ourselves, which is more error-prone. |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| # This structure taken from `libc.h` | ||
| # https://github.com/ifduyue/musl/blob/aad50fcd791e009961621ddfbe3d4c245fd689a3/src/internal/libc.h#L14-L18 | ||
| struct musl_tls_module | ||
| next::Ptr{musl_tls_module} | ||
| image::Ptr{musl_tls_module} | ||
| len::Csize_t | ||
| size::Csize_t | ||
| align::Csize_t | ||
| offset::Csize_t | ||
| end | ||
|
|
||
| # This structure taken from `ldso/dynlink.c` | ||
| # https://github.com/ifduyue/musl/blob/aad50fcd791e009961621ddfbe3d4c245fd689a3/ldso/dynlink.c#L53-L107 | ||
| struct musl_dso | ||
| # Things we find mildly interesting | ||
| base::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| name::Ptr{UInt8} | ||
|
|
||
| # The wasteland of things we don't care about | ||
| dynv::Ptr{Csize_t} | ||
| next::Ptr{musl_dso} | ||
| prev::Ptr{musl_dso} | ||
|
|
||
| phdr::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| phnum::Cint | ||
| phentsize::Csize_t | ||
|
|
||
| syms::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| hashtab::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| ghashtab::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| versym::Ptr{Int16} | ||
| strings::Ptr{UInt8} | ||
| syms_next::Ptr{musl_dso} | ||
| lazy_next::Ptr{musl_dso} | ||
| lazy::Ptr{Csize_t} | ||
| lazy_cnt::Csize_t | ||
|
|
||
| map::Ptr{Cuchar} | ||
| map_len::Csize_t | ||
|
|
||
| # We assume that dev_t and ino_t are always `uint64_t`, even on 32-bit systems. | ||
| dev::UInt64 | ||
| ino::UInt64 | ||
| relocated::Cchar | ||
| constructed::Cchar | ||
| kernel_mapped::Cchar | ||
| mark::Cchar | ||
| bfs_built::Cchar | ||
| runtime_loaded::Cchar | ||
| # NOTE: struct layout rules should insert two bytes of space here | ||
| deps::Ptr{Ptr{musl_dso}} | ||
| needed_by::Ptr{musl_dso} | ||
| ndeps_direct::Csize_t | ||
| next_dep::Csize_t | ||
| ctor_visitor::Cint | ||
| rpath_orig::Ptr{UInt8} | ||
| rpath::Ptr{UInt8} | ||
|
|
||
| tls::musl_tls_module | ||
| tls_id::Csize_t | ||
| relro_start::Csize_t | ||
| relro_end::Csize_t | ||
| new_dtv::Ptr{Ptr{Cuint}} | ||
| new_tls::Ptr{UInt8} | ||
| td_index::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| fini_next::Ptr{musl_dso} | ||
|
|
||
| # Finally! The field we're interested in! | ||
| shortname::Ptr{UInt8} | ||
|
|
||
| # We'll put this stuff at the end because it might be interesting to someone somewhere | ||
| loadmap::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| funcdesc::Ptr{Cvoid} | ||
| got::Ptr{Csize_t} | ||
| end | ||
|
|
||
| function replace_musl_shortname(lib_handle::Ptr{Cvoid}) | ||
| # First, find the absolute path of the library we're talking about | ||
| lib_path = abspath(dlpath(lib_handle)) | ||
|
|
||
| # Load the DSO object, which conveniently is the handle that `dlopen()` | ||
| # itself passes back to us. Check to make sure it's what we expect, by | ||
| # inspecting the `name` field. If it's not, something has gone wrong, | ||
| # and we should stop before touching anything else. | ||
| dso = unsafe_load(Ptr{musl_dso}(lib_handle)) | ||
| dso_name = abspath(unsafe_string(dso.name)) | ||
| if dso_name != lib_path | ||
| @debug("Unable to synchronize to DSO structure", name=dso_name, path=lib_path) | ||
| return lib_handle | ||
| end | ||
|
|
||
| # If the shortname is not NULL, break out. | ||
| if dso.shortname != C_NULL | ||
| @debug("shortname != NULL!", ptr=shortname_ptr, value=unsafe_string(shortname_ptr)) | ||
| return lib_handle | ||
| end | ||
|
|
||
| # Calculate the offset of `shortname` from the base pointer of the DSO object | ||
| shortname_offset = fieldoffset(musl_dso, findfirst(fieldnames(musl_dso) .== :shortname)) | ||

| # Replace the shortname with the basename of lib_path. Note that, in general, this | ||
| # should be the SONAME, but not always. If we wanted to be pedantic, we should | ||
| # actually parse out the SONAME of this object. But we don't want to be. | ||
| new_shortname = basename(lib_path) | ||
| push!(manual_gc_roots, new_shortname) | ||
| unsafe_store!(Ptr{Ptr{UInt8}}(lib_handle + shortname_offset), pointer(new_shortname)) | ||
| return lib_handle | ||
| end | ||
